Juventus will look to sign Barcelona striker Luis Suarez if the Spanish champions re-sign Brazil forward Neymar from Paris St-Germain. (Tuttosport)

Turkish side Fenerbahce are ‘closing in’ on signing Manchester United defender Marcos Rojo on loan. (Manchester Evening News)

Arsenal are planning to offer 20-year-old midfielder Matteo Guendouzi a new five-year contract, which would double his wages to £70,000-a-week. (Daily Mail)

Daniel Sturridge has touched down in Turkey ahead of sealing his move to Super Lig side Trabzonspor. (Daily Mirror)

Real Madrid striker Luka Jovic could join AC Milan on loan – just two months after the 21-year-old Serbia international’s £62m to the Bernabeu. (Gazzetta)

Monaco have agreed a deal to sign Southampton’s Gabon midfielder Mario Lemina on a season-long loan deal with an option to buy. (RMC)

Besiktas have agreed a season-long loan deal with Tottenham’s 24-year-old French winger Georges-Kevin N’Koudou. (TRT Spor)

Spurs midfielder Victor Wanyama is a target for Belgian side Club Bruges. The 28-year-old is rated at £18m. (Daily Express)

Liverpool have received an offer from Danish Superliga club Nordsjaelland for talented young striker Bobby Duncan. The 18-year-old, Steven Gerrard’s cousin, scored 32 goals for the Liverpool academy last year and is wanted on loan. (Daily Mail)
